WebDec 2, 2016 · The share of wages in the GDP fell from 64% to 54%, and overall, wage earners have lost a third of their purchasing power. The average purchasing power fell from 84% of the average for the EU15 to 65%. Between 2008 and 2015, 427,000 Greeks emigrated, the great majority university-educated.
